
Senate Candidate Tom Leppert Talks About His Jobs Plan on KFYO, Pledges to Serve No More Than Two Terms
Tom Leppert is a businessman and former Dallas mayor, now running for the Senate seat held by Kay Bailey Hutchison, who is not running for re-election in 2012. On Lubbock’s First News on KFYO, he talked about his jobs plan, which includes tax reform and reducing the role of government.
Leppert says he’s not a career politician.
“I don’t want another career, ” Leppert said. “I’m very happy to put a limitation on it. No more than two terms. The reality of it is we’re going to have to address this fiscal situation in the next term.”
